    Scion TC Wheels for Carolla??

    There are two bolt patterns for corollas depending on chassis code. E170 = 5x100(USDM Corolla, asian, GCC Corolla/Corolla Altis, etc). E180 = 5x114.3 (EU Corolla, Auris, USDM iM, China Corolla, etc.)

    Scion TC Wheels for Carolla??

    PCD is 5x114 so it is not bolt on to a Corolla which needa 5x100.. You would need a pcd converter but offset is already 39mm so adding a converter with typical thickness of 25mm would result in a 14mm offset which would be too low, unless you want your wheels to poke out of the wheel well.

    Factory Bluetooth mic

    The factory mic is integrated behind the map light panel. Wiring to the non-entune radio is as attached. There are 5 wires for the mic. Pins 4, 5, 6, 18 and 19 of the 28 pin connector (E111).

    ECO vs Non ECO

    Eco engine is 2ZR-FAE (non eco is 2ZR-FE) which has variable lift aside from dual variable valve timing. It alsp has higher compression as previously mentioned.

    Chrome Brakes

    The coating will be worn when you break in the newly painted rotors. What will be left are the coating/paint on the area that isn't in contact with the brake pads. Those coatings are only useful for rust prevention and nothing else.

    D2 racing springs

    Search for "SPC ez shim 75600" or "specialty product 75600" for rear camber/toe shims for corolla on ebay or amazon. If you have rear discs, you will also need spacers to align caliper to rotor. Look for "spc ez shim spacer 75970".

    Automatic Windows

    Oem auto window on all 4 doors require different switches to all 4 doors. The connectors and wiring is different since all the window signals will now go through the LIN network compared to the driver window only.
